当前位置: 首页 > news >正文

全球首位AI程序员诞生,会抢走程序员的饭碗吗?

前言

唉!又谈起令我担心的了,我以前想着程序员不应该开发AI来完成编写代码吧!不然他的职位怎么办?他不可能自己灭了自己的工作吧?

可是,这几年来,该来的总是来,ai程序员诞生了!

对于这个问题呢我想了很久,我想从以下观点分析这个问题,也是大家最担心的一个问题!

随着人工智能技术的飞速发展,全球首位AI程序员已经诞生。这一创新性的进展引发了人们对于AI是否会取代程序员的广泛讨论。本文旨在通过深入分析AI程序员的技术特点、应用场景以及其与人类程序员的互补性,探讨AI程序员是否真的会抢走程序员的饭碗。

一、引言

近年来,人工智能技术在各个领域取得了显著进展,其中AI程序员的出现更是引起了广泛关注。AI程序员利用机器学习、自然语言处理等先进技术,能够自动完成代码编写、调试和优化等任务。然而,这一新兴技术是否会对传统程序员产生冲击,甚至取代他们,成为了业界和学术界热议的话题。

二、AI程序员的技术特点与应用场景

AI程序员具备强大的自动化编程能力,能够根据需求自动生成代码,并在一定程度上实现自我优化。此外,AI程序员还能通过自然语言与人类进行交互,理解并执行复杂的编程指令。这使得AI程序员在重复性、繁琐性较高的编程任务中具有明显优势。

在应用场景方面,AI程序员可广泛应用于软件开发、数据分析、自动化测试等领域。例如,在软件开发过程中,AI程序员可以辅助人类程序员完成代码编写和调试工作,提高开发效率;在数据分析领域,AI程序员能够自动处理海量数据,提取有价值的信息,为决策提供有力支持。

三、AI程序员与人类程序员的互补性

尽管AI程序员在编程领域具有一定的优势,但人类程序员在创造性、灵活性和经验积累等方面仍具有不可替代的地位。首先,人类程序员能够充分发挥创造性思维,设计出新颖、独特的软件解决方案;其次,在面对复杂多变的实际问题时,人类程序员能够灵活运用所学知识,迅速调整方案,解决问题;最后,丰富的经验积累使得人类程序员在应对突发情况、优化系统性能等方面具有独特优势。

因此,AI程序员与人类程序员并非竞争关系,而是互补关系。AI程序员可以承担大量重复性、繁琐性的编程任务,释放人类程序员的双手,让他们有更多时间和精力投入到更具创新性和挑战性的工作中。

四、结论

综上所述,全球首位AI程序员的诞生虽然在一定程度上改变了编程领域的格局,但并不会完全取代人类程序员。相反,AI程序员与人类程序员将形成紧密的合作关系,共同推动编程领域的发展。在未来,随着人工智能技术的不断进步和完善,AI程序员与人类程序员的互补性将更加凸显,共同创造出更加繁荣、高效的编程生态。

五、展望

展望未来,我们期待看到更多关于AI程序员与人类程序员协同工作的研究和实践。同时,我们也需要关注到AI程序员可能带来的伦理、法律和社会问题,制定相应的规范和政策,确保技术的健康发展。此外,随着技术的不断进步,我们还需要关注AI程序员在编程领域的局限性,并努力突破这些限制,以推动整个行业的持续创新和发展。

总之,全球首位AI程序员的诞生是一个里程碑式的事件,它标志着人工智能技术在编程领域的重要突破。然而,这并不意味着AI程序员会完全取代人类程序员。相反,我们应该看到AI程序员与人类程序员的互补性和合作潜力,共同推动编程领域的进步和发展。

相关文章:

  • C# 读取指定文件夹
  • 【PMP】每日一练2
  • 前端项目构建过程中涉及低代码部分思考
  • 2024年3月22蚂蚁新村今日答案:以下哪一项是陕西省的非遗美食?
  • 大数据-基础架构设施演进的过程
  • Android学习进阶
  • Mapper.xml映射文件
  • 【笔记】Python学习记录
  • Windows 11 安装 Scoop
  • Mysql数据库:索引管理
  • 【算法与数据结构】二叉树(前中后)序遍历
  • 自营、入驻商城小程序开发
  • Charles 工具如何做断点测试?
  • 流畅的 Python 第二版(GPT 重译)(二)
  • Elastic-Job 分布式任务调度
  • 【399天】跃迁之路——程序员高效学习方法论探索系列(实验阶段156-2018.03.11)...
  • C# 免费离线人脸识别 2.0 Demo
  • Java IO学习笔记一
  • spring cloud gateway 源码解析(4)跨域问题处理
  • vue-router 实现分析
  • Vue全家桶实现一个Web App
  • webpack+react项目初体验——记录我的webpack环境配置
  • 爱情 北京女病人
  • 第13期 DApp 榜单 :来,吃我这波安利
  • 技术攻略】php设计模式(一):简介及创建型模式
  • 开年巨制!千人千面回放技术让你“看到”Flutter用户侧问题
  • 开源中国专访:Chameleon原理首发,其它跨多端统一框架都是假的?
  • 算法之不定期更新(一)(2018-04-12)
  • linux 淘宝开源监控工具tsar
  • 阿里云移动端播放器高级功能介绍
  • ​学习一下,什么是预包装食品?​
  • ​业务双活的数据切换思路设计(下)
  • #我与Java虚拟机的故事#连载04:一本让自己没面子的书
  • (03)光刻——半导体电路的绘制
  • (arch)linux 转换文件编码格式
  • (C#)Windows Shell 外壳编程系列9 - QueryInfo 扩展提示
  • (C语言)二分查找 超详细
  • (PWM呼吸灯)合泰开发板HT66F2390-----点灯大师
  • (六)c52学习之旅-独立按键
  • (每日持续更新)jdk api之FileFilter基础、应用、实战
  • (五) 一起学 Unix 环境高级编程 (APUE) 之 进程环境
  • (转)程序员技术练级攻略
  • (转)使用VMware vSphere标准交换机设置网络连接
  • .net 4.0发布后不能正常显示图片问题
  • .net 8 发布了,试下微软最近强推的MAUI
  • .NET CORE 3.1 集成JWT鉴权和授权2
  • .NET Core MongoDB数据仓储和工作单元模式封装
  • .Net FrameWork总结
  • .NET MVC第五章、模型绑定获取表单数据
  • .net 简单实现MD5
  • .Net通用分页类(存储过程分页版,可以选择页码的显示样式,且有中英选择)
  • /var/lib/dpkg/lock 锁定问题
  • [16/N]论得趣
  • [2019.3.20]BZOJ4573 [Zjoi2016]大森林
  • [20190113]四校联考